U.S. patent number D753,137 [Application Number D/487,178] was granted by the patent office on 2016-04-05 for display screen with transitional graphical user interface. The grantee listed for this patent is Hsien-Wen Chang. Invention is credited to Hsien-Wen Chang.

Description



FIG. 1 is a front view of the first image of a display screen with transitional graphical user interface showing a first embodiment thereof;

FIG. 2 is a front view of the second image of a display screen with transitional graphical user interface showing a first embodiment thereof;

FIG. 3 is a front view of the first image of a display screen with transitional graphical user interface showing a second embodiment thereof; and,

FIG. 4 is a front view of the second image of a display screen with transitional graphical user interface showing a second embodiment thereof.

The appearance of the transitional image sequentially transitions between the images shown in FIGS. 1-2 of the first embodiment, and FIGS. 3-4 of the second embodiment. The process or period in which one image transitions to another image forms no part of the claimed design.

The broken line showing of the display screen is for the purpose of illustrating environmental structure and forms no part of the claimed design. The broken line showing the remainder of the image in all views within the display screen illustrates unclaimed portions of the design and forms no part thereof.
